Duties and Responsibilities:
- Management of all financial aspects of a practice
- Scheduling of patient appointments
- Supervision and management of staff
- Timely filing and maintenance of insurance claims
- Taking care of marketing and public relations
- Implementing procedures and policies
Skills and Qualifications:
- Leadership skills: This involves coordinating daily procedures and handling any staff or patient issues that may arise. They may need conflict management, communication and motivation skills to ensure that an office runs smoothly
- Knowledge of safety regulations and compliance standards: These professionals also need to make sure that a dental practice adheres to Occupational Safety and Health Administration compliance standards. They need to be up-to-date with regard to this information and be confident enforcing it in the workplace as well.
- Computer skills: A Dental Office Manager spends a considerable amount of time doing computer-related work, such as email correspondence, financial transactions and scheduling of appointments. Basic troubleshooting skills can also benefit these professionals.
- Organizational skills: As these professionals are responsible for keeping daily operations running smoothly, they need to be organized individuals.
